πŸ“ŠπŸŒͺ️ Understanding Economic Instability

In times of economic instability, creating a personal financial plan becomes especially relevant. It helps ensure financial stability and protection from unforeseen economic events.

Key Steps to Understanding the Situation:

  • Current Economic Conditions Analysis: Assessing the economic climate and its potential impact on personal finances.
  • Defining Your Financial Goals: Clearly defining your short-term and long-term financial goals.
  • Realistic Planning: Considering potential economic risks and creating a plan for different scenarios.

Conscious planning and readiness for change will help reduce financial risks in unstable conditions.

πŸ“ˆπŸ” Investing and Saving in an Unsustainable Economy

In times of economic instability, it is important to approach investing and saving with special caution. Rational management of investments and savings helps to minimize risks and maintain financial stability.

Strategies for Investing and Savings:

  • Investment Diversification: Spreading investments across different assets to reduce risks.
  • Cautious Investing: Avoiding high-risk investments in uncertain times.
  • Savings Automation: Regularly and automatically put aside a portion of your income into a savings account or fund.

This approach allows you to save and increase funds, reducing financial risks in an unstable economy.

πŸ›‘οΈπŸ§© Risk Management Strategies

Risk management is a key component of personal financial planning, especially in times of economic uncertainty. This involves identifying potential financial threats and developing strategies to minimize them.

Key Risk Management Strategies:

  • Financial Risk Analysis: Identifying potential financial threats and assessing their impact.
  • Insurance: Using insurance products to protect against unexpected events such as illness or job loss.
  • Emergency Funds: Create reserve funds to cope with unexpected expenses or loss of income.

Using these strategies helps create a more resilient financial plan that can withstand economic fluctuations.
